What Are Childhood and Developmental Disorders?
Childhood and developmental disorders are conditions that emerge early in a child’s life and affect how the brain develops, processes information, and regulates behavior. The DSM-5 groups these under the umbrella term neurodevelopmental disorders, a category that includes ADHD, Autism Spectrum Disorder, intellectual disability, communication disorders, and specific learning disorders. What unites them is timing and origin: symptoms appear during the developmental period, typically before age twelve, and they trace back to how the brain is wired rather than to an injury or illness acquired later in life.
Two conditions dominate both clinical caseloads and public conversation: ADHD and autism spectrum disorder. Together they account for the majority of neurodevelopmental referrals in pediatric clinics across the United States and United Kingdom. Understanding them side by side, rather than in isolation, is essential, because the two conditions overlap far more than most people assume and are frequently confused with each other in casual conversation, and sometimes even in early clinical assessment.

According to the Centers for Disease Control and Prevention, ADHD remains one of the most common neurodevelopmental disorders of childhood, and diagnosis rates have risen steadily as awareness, screening tools, and access to evaluation have improved. Autism prevalence has followed a similar upward trajectory, which researchers attribute mainly to broader diagnostic criteria and better identification rather than a true explosion in underlying rates.
Core distinction to hold onto: ADHD is fundamentally a disorder of attention regulation and impulse control. Autism is fundamentally a disorder of social communication and repetitive, restricted behavior patterns. They can exist separately, together, or be mistaken for one another — and the DSM-5 now allows both diagnoses in the same child, a significant shift from earlier diagnostic manuals.
Attention-Deficit/Hyperactivity Disorder
What Is ADHD? Definition, Symptoms, and Diagnostic Subtypes
ADHD, or Attention-Deficit/Hyperactivity Disorder, is a neurodevelopmental disorder marked by a persistent pattern of inattention, hyperactivity, and impulsivity that interferes with functioning at school, home, or work. It is not simply a child being “difficult” or a parent failing to enforce discipline. It reflects measurable differences in the brain’s executive functioning networks, particularly the circuits linking the prefrontal cortex to deeper structures that regulate attention and inhibition.
The National Institute of Mental Health defines ADHD as an ongoing pattern that includes difficulty sustaining attention, hyperactivity, and impulsive behavior, and notes that symptoms must be present in more than one setting to warrant diagnosis. That last requirement matters: a child who struggles only at home but performs fine at school does not automatically meet criteria, because context-specific difficulty often points to something other than ADHD.
The Three DSM-5 Presentations of ADHD
The DSM-5 organizes ADHD into three presentations based on which symptom cluster dominates. Students studying the DSM-5 diagnostic framework will recognize this pattern across many disorders: a shared symptom pool that gets subdivided by which features are most prominent.
Predominantly Inattentive Presentation. The child struggles to sustain focus, loses track of tasks, appears not to listen, and is easily distracted, without significant hyperactivity or impulsivity. This presentation is frequently missed because these children are quiet rather than disruptive, and teachers are far more likely to refer a child who is bouncing off the walls than one who is silently daydreaming.
Predominantly Hyperactive-Impulsive Presentation. The child fidgets constantly, struggles to remain seated, talks excessively, interrupts others, and acts without thinking through consequences. This presentation is identified earlier and more often, partly because it is more visible and disruptive in a classroom setting.
Combined Presentation. The child shows significant symptoms from both clusters. This is the most commonly diagnosed presentation in children, particularly boys.
Quick Symptom Checklist Students Should Know
DSM-5 requires at least six inattentive symptoms or six hyperactive-impulsive symptoms (five for adolescents 17 and older) present for at least six months, appearing before age 12, occurring in two or more settings, and clearly interfering with functioning. A single symptom, or symptoms confined to one setting, does not meet threshold.
What Does ADHD Look Like Day to Day?
In practice, ADHD shows up as homework left half finished, instructions that need repeating three times, toys and papers scattered everywhere, and social friction caused by blurting out comments or struggling to wait a turn. It is not a lack of intelligence; many children with ADHD are highly capable but cannot consistently marshal their attention toward the task in front of them. The American Academy of Pediatrics clinical guideline on ADHD stresses that diagnosis should draw on information from multiple informants, including parents and teachers, because behavior can look markedly different across settings with different demands and structure.
Executive Function: The Hidden Core of ADHD
Underneath the visible symptoms of ADHD sits a deficit in executive function — the mental skills that let a person plan, organize, hold information in mind, and regulate impulses. This connects ADHD directly to broader work on cognitive development and executive functioning. Children with ADHD often show working memory limitations, weaker inhibitory control, and difficulty with time perception, which is why tasks that require holding several steps in mind, like multi-step homework instructions, are disproportionately hard for them.
Autism Spectrum Disorder
What Is Autism Spectrum Disorder? Core Features and Definition
Autism Spectrum Disorder (ASD) is a neurodevelopmental disorder defined by two core symptom domains: persistent differences in social communication and social interaction, and restricted, repetitive patterns of behavior, interests, or activities. The word “spectrum” in the name is deliberate. Autism does not present the same way in any two children; it spans wide variation in language ability, intellectual functioning, sensory sensitivity, and support needs.
The CDC’s autism overview describes ASD as a developmental disability caused by differences in the brain that can affect how a person communicates, interacts, behaves, and learns, and notes that people with autism may communicate, interact, behave, and learn in ways that are different from most other people.
Social Communication Differences
Children with autism often show reduced eye contact, difficulty reading facial expressions and tone of voice, delayed or atypical language development, and challenges building peer relationships appropriate to their developmental level. Some children with autism are highly verbal and articulate but still struggle with the unspoken rules of conversation, such as when to change topics or how to read sarcasm. This connects to the psychological construct of theory of mind — the ability to infer what another person is thinking or feeling — which research consistently shows develops differently in many autistic children.
Restricted and Repetitive Behaviors
The second core domain includes repetitive motor movements such as hand-flapping or rocking, insistence on sameness and intense distress at small changes in routine, highly focused and intense interests, and unusual sensory reactions to sound, light, texture, or touch. A child who becomes deeply distressed by a scratchy shirt tag, or who can recite every fact about trains but struggles with small talk, is showing a textbook pattern of this second domain.

Level 1: Requiring Support
Noticeable social communication difficulties without support; can hold conversations but struggles with back-and-forth exchange and making friends; some inflexibility interferes across contexts.
S
Level 2: Requiring Substantial Support
Marked social communication deficits even with support in place; limited initiation of social interaction; inflexibility and repetitive behavior obvious to a casual observer and disruptive to functioning.
S
Level 3: Requiring Very Substantial Support
Severe deficits in verbal and nonverbal social communication skills; very limited initiation of interaction; extreme difficulty coping with change; behaviors markedly interfere with functioning across settings.

Early Identification Milestones
Reduced response to name by 12 months, limited pointing or gesturing by 18 months, no meaningful two-word phrases by 24 months, and loss of previously acquired skills at any age are all recognized red flags.
How Common Is Autism, and Has It Truly Become More Common?
The most recent CDC Autism and Developmental Disabilities Monitoring Network report tracks autism prevalence across multiple U.S. sites and has documented a steady rise in identified cases over the past two decades. Most researchers attribute this rise primarily to improved awareness, broader diagnostic criteria introduced in the DSM-5, and better access to evaluation services, particularly among girls and children from historically underdiagnosed communities, rather than a genuine surge in the underlying biological rate.

ADHD vs Autism: Similarities, Differences, and Overlap
The relationship between ADHD and autism spectrum disorder is one of the most frequently misunderstood topics in child development, and one of the most commonly tested distinctions in psychology coursework. The two conditions share surface-level features, particularly around attention and social difficulty, which is exactly why they get confused. But the underlying mechanisms diverge sharply.
✓ ADHD
- Core deficit: attention regulation and impulse control
- Social difficulty is usually a byproduct of impulsivity, not a primary deficit in reading social cues
- Language development is typically age-appropriate
- Symptoms often improve with structure, medication, and behavioral therapy
- Diagnosed on average between ages 4 and 12
- Restricted or repetitive interests are uncommon as a core feature
✗ Autism Spectrum Disorder
- Core deficit: social communication and restricted/repetitive behavior
- Social difficulty is a primary feature, tied to theory of mind and social reciprocity
- Language development is often delayed or atypical, though not always
- Sensory sensitivities and insistence on sameness are common core features
- Can often be identified reliably by age 2 to 3
- Restricted, intense interests are a defining diagnostic feature
Why the Two Conditions Are So Often Confused
Both conditions can produce a child who seems inattentive in class, struggles with peer relationships, and has trouble with transitions. A child with ADHD may appear “in their own world” because they are distracted, while a child with autism may appear the same way because they are deeply focused on an internal interest or overwhelmed by sensory input. The surface behavior looks similar; the underlying cause is different, and getting that distinction right shapes which interventions will actually help.
Can a Child Have Both ADHD and Autism?
Yes, and this is one of the most important updates in modern diagnostic practice. Earlier editions of the DSM did not allow a clinician to diagnose both ADHD and autism in the same person; DSM-5 removed that exclusion criterion. Research published in the Journal of Child Psychology and Psychiatry has found that a substantial share of children diagnosed with autism also meet full criteria for ADHD, and that co-occurring ADHD symptoms in autistic children are linked to greater everyday functional impairment than either condition alone.
⚠️ Common misconception: Autism is not simply “severe ADHD,” and ADHD is not a “mild form of autism.” They sit on separate diagnostic axes measuring different underlying processes. A child can have severe ADHD and no autism traits at all, or mild ADHD symptoms alongside significant autism-related social and sensory needs. Severity on one dimension tells you nothing about where a child sits on the other.
The Masking Phenomenon
Masking, sometimes called camouflaging, refers to the conscious or unconscious effort some autistic children and adults make to hide their traits and mimic neurotypical social behavior. It is far more commonly documented in girls and women, which is one reason autism has historically been underdiagnosed in female populations. A masking child may hold it together at school through sheer effort and then have an emotional collapse at home once the demand to perform normalcy lifts — a pattern parents sometimes call an “after-school restraint collapse.”
Etiology & Risk Factors
Causes and Risk Factors: Genetics, Brain Development, and Environment
Neither ADHD nor autism has a single identified cause. Both are understood as multifactorial conditions arising from an interaction between genetic predisposition and prenatal or early developmental influences on brain formation. Genetic Contributions
Twin and family studies consistently place the heritability of both ADHD and autism above 70 percent, among the highest heritability estimates of any psychiatric or developmental condition. A large-scale genome analysis published via the Nature Genetics consortium identified multiple common genetic variants associated with ADHD risk, confirming that ADHD is a polygenic condition shaped by many genes of small individual effect rather than a single “ADHD gene.” Autism shows a similarly complex genetic architecture, involving both common variants and rare, high-impact mutations.
Brain Structure and Function
Neuroimaging research has repeatedly found differences in brain structure and connectivity in children with ADHD, particularly in the prefrontal cortex, basal ganglia, and the circuits linking them, regions central to attention and inhibitory control. In autism, structural and functional imaging studies point to differences in brain connectivity patterns, particularly in regions supporting social cognition and sensory integration. Neither pattern reflects damage; both reflect a different developmental trajectory of otherwise normal brain tissue.
Prenatal and Perinatal Risk Factors
Certain prenatal exposures are associated with elevated risk for both conditions, including premature birth, low birth weight, maternal smoking or alcohol use during pregnancy, and significant prenatal stress or complications. These are risk factors, not guaranteed causes; the large majority of children exposed to any single one of these factors do not develop either disorder.
What does NOT cause ADHD or autism:
Vaccines do not cause autism. This claim has been investigated extensively and repeatedly disproven, most notably by large-scale epidemiological studies including a Danish cohort study of over 650,000 children published in the Annals of Internal Medicine, which found no association between the MMR vaccine and autism risk. Parenting style, screen time alone, sugar intake, and poor discipline do not cause either condition, though they can influence how symptoms are expressed or managed day to day.
Sex Differences in Diagnosis
Boys are diagnosed with both ADHD and autism at substantially higher rates than girls, but the gap is narrower in reality than in diagnosis statistics. Girls with ADHD more often present with the inattentive subtype, which is quieter and easier to overlook, and girls with autism are more likely to mask social difficulties, delaying diagnosis, sometimes into adulthood. Clinicians and researchers increasingly recognize this diagnostic bias as a significant equity issue in child mental health.
Clinical Assessment
How ADHD and Autism Are Diagnosed
Diagnosing either condition requires a structured clinical process, not a single test or blood panel. There is no biomarker that confirms ADHD or autism on its own; diagnosis relies on behavioral observation, developmental history, and standardized rating tools gathered across settings and informants.
The ADHD Diagnostic Process
1
Comprehensive Developmental History
A clinician gathers information on when symptoms started, how they have evolved, and whether they appear across multiple settings such as home, school, and extracurricular activities.
2
Standardized Rating Scales
Parents and teachers complete validated tools such as the Vanderbilt or Conners rating scales, which quantify inattentive and hyperactive-impulsive symptoms against normed benchmarks for the child’s age.
3
Ruling Out Other Explanations
Clinicians screen for conditions that can mimic ADHD, including anxiety, learning disorders, sleep problems, and hearing difficulties, since these can all produce inattentive-looking behavior.
4
Applying DSM-5 Criteria
The clinician checks the symptom count, duration, cross-setting presence, and functional impairment against formal DSM-5 thresholds before assigning a diagnosis and presentation type.
The Autism Diagnostic Process
Autism evaluation is typically more intensive and multidisciplinary. It often involves a developmental pediatrician, psychologist, and sometimes a speech-language pathologist or occupational therapist working together. The gold-standard tool is the Autism Diagnostic Observation Schedule (ADOS-2), a structured, play-based observation that lets clinicians directly assess social communication and repetitive behavior in a standardized format. This is typically paired with a detailed developmental history, often gathered through the Autism Diagnostic Interview-Revised (ADI-R) with parents.
The American Academy of Pediatrics recommends universal autism screening at the 18-month and 24-month well-child visits using validated tools such as the M-CHAT-R, precisely because early identification is strongly linked to better long-term outcomes.
| Diagnostic Feature | ADHD | Autism Spectrum Disorder |
|---|---|---|
| Core symptom domains | Inattention; hyperactivity-impulsivity | Social communication deficits; restricted/repetitive behavior |
| Typical age of identification | 4–12 years | 2–4 years (often earlier with screening) |
| Key diagnostic tools | Vanderbilt/Conners rating scales, clinical interview | ADOS-2, ADI-R, developmental history |
| Number of symptoms required (DSM-5) | 6+ from one domain (5+ for age 17 and older) | All 3 social communication criteria + 2 of 4 repetitive behavior criteria |
| Setting requirement | Present in 2+ settings | Present across contexts, though may be masked in some settings |
| Can be diagnosed together? | Yes — DSM-5 explicitly permits dual diagnosis of ADHD and ASD | |

Overlapping Conditions
Co-Occurring Conditions and Comorbidities
Children with ADHD or autism rarely present with just one diagnosis. Comorbidity is the rule rather than the exception, and untangling which symptoms belong to which condition is one of the hardest parts of clinical assessment.
Common ADHD Comorbidities
Anxiety disorders, oppositional defiant disorder, specific learning disorders such as dyslexia, and sleep disturbances frequently accompany ADHD. Research summarized by the anxiety disorders literature shows that children with ADHD experience significantly elevated rates of co-occurring anxiety compared to their neurotypical peers, which can complicate treatment because stimulant medication sometimes intensifies anxiety symptoms in a subset of children.
Common Autism Comorbidities
Alongside ADHD, autistic children commonly experience anxiety, gastrointestinal difficulties, sleep disorders, and, in some cases, intellectual disability or specific learning disorders. Sensory processing differences, while not a standalone DSM-5 diagnosis, are formally recognized as a diagnostic criterion within autism itself and significantly shape daily functioning, from tolerance of clothing textures to reaction to fluorescent lighting in classrooms.
Clinical nuance: A child in significant physical or emotional pain sometimes cannot communicate that distress in typical ways, particularly when autism affects expressive language. Research summarized in work on pain assessment in children with autism spectrum disorder highlights how easily pain and distress can be misread as behavioral symptoms rather than a medical signal, which is a critical consideration for both clinicians and caregivers.
Untangling Overlapping Symptoms
Because inattention can stem from ADHD, anxiety, sensory overload, or an autism-related fixation on an internal interest, careful differential diagnosis matters enormously. A misattributed symptom leads to a mismatched intervention: a stimulant medication will not address a sensory-driven attention lapse, and a social skills group will not address a working-memory deficit rooted in ADHD.

Treatment and Intervention Approaches
Neither ADHD nor autism is “cured” in the medical sense, because both are differences in brain development rather than diseases with a defined endpoint. Treatment instead focuses on reducing functional impairment, building skills, and improving quality of life, using approaches tailored to the specific child.
ADHD Treatment Pathways
Behavioral therapy is the recommended first-line treatment for younger children with ADHD, according to AAP clinical guidance, and focuses on parent training in behavior management techniques, structured routines, and consistent reinforcement systems. Stimulant medications, such as methylphenidate and amphetamine-based formulations, remain the most extensively researched pharmacological treatment for ADHD and show strong efficacy in reducing core symptoms for the majority of children, though response and side-effect profiles vary individually. Non-stimulant medications provide an alternative for children who do not tolerate stimulants well. Autism Intervention Approaches
Applied Behavior Analysis (ABA) is among the most researched autism interventions, focused on reinforcing desired behaviors and building communication and daily living skills through structured, individualized programs. Speech and language therapy addresses communication delays and pragmatic language skills. Occupational therapy targets sensory processing differences and fine motor skill development. Social skills training helps children practice reciprocal conversation and peer interaction in structured, supportive settings. Approaches to autism intervention have evolved considerably, with growing emphasis on neurodiversity-affirming practices that respect autistic communication styles rather than solely targeting behavior suppression.
| Intervention | Primary Target | Best Evidence For | Typical Providers |
|---|---|---|---|
| Behavioral parent training | Behavior regulation, home routines | ADHD, especially preschool and early school-age | Psychologist, behavioral therapist |
| Stimulant medication | Attention, impulse control | ADHD across most age groups | Pediatrician, child psychiatrist |
| Applied Behavior Analysis | Skill building, communication, behavior | Autism, particularly early intervention | Board Certified Behavior Analyst |
| Speech-language therapy | Communication and pragmatic language | Autism; some ADHD-related language delays | Speech-language pathologist |
| Occupational therapy | Sensory processing, fine motor skills | Autism; some ADHD-related coordination issues | Occupational therapist |
| School accommodations (IEP/504) | Classroom access and academic support | Both ADHD and autism | School psychologist, special education team |
The Role of School-Based Support
In the U.S., children with ADHD or autism may qualify for an Individualized Education Program (IEP) or a 504 Plan, both of which provide legally mandated accommodations such as extended test time, preferential seating, movement breaks, or a modified curriculum. In the UK, similar support is provided through an Education, Health and Care Plan (EHCP). Developmental Trajectory
ADHD and Autism Across School, College, and Adulthood
Both conditions are lifelong, even though the label “childhood disorder” suggests otherwise. Roughly 60 percent of children with ADHD continue to meet criteria into adulthood, and autism, by definition, persists across the lifespan, though how it presents can shift considerably as coping skills, environment, and self-understanding evolve.
Elementary and Secondary School
This is typically when both conditions are first identified and formally supported, through screening, teacher referral, and formal evaluation. Consistent structure, clear expectations, and collaboration between home and school produce the strongest outcomes at this stage. The College Transition
College presents a unique challenge because the built-in structure of the K-12 system disappears. Students with ADHD must self-manage deadlines, unstructured study time, and competing priorities without daily parental or teacher oversight, which is precisely where symptoms tend to resurface even in students who did well in a highly structured high school environment. Autistic college students often face challenges around sensory overload in dormitories and lecture halls, navigating unwritten social norms, and communicating support needs to professors who may have limited disorder-specific training. U.S. colleges are legally required to provide reasonable accommodations under the Americans with Disabilities Act, typically coordinated through a campus disability services office.
Adulthood and the Workplace
Undiagnosed or unsupported ADHD in adulthood is associated with higher rates of job instability, relationship strain, and co-occurring mood disorders, which is why later-in-life diagnosis, increasingly common among women, often brings significant relief and a reframing of decades of self-blame. Autistic adults increasingly advocate for workplace accommodations such as flexible communication formats, reduced sensory demands, and clear, literal task instructions, reflecting a broader shift toward a strengths-based, neurodiversity-affirming framework rather than a purely deficit-focused model.
A Note on Language: Person-First vs Identity-First
Clinical writing has traditionally used person-first language (“a child with autism”), while many autistic self-advocates prefer identity-first language (“an autistic child”), viewing autism as a core part of identity rather than an add-on condition. Both usages appear throughout current academic literature, and awareness of this preference debate itself is considered good practice in contemporary psychology writing.

Key Organizations and Researchers Shaping the Field
The modern understanding of ADHD and autism rests on decades of work by specific institutions and researchers whose findings continue to shape diagnostic criteria and treatment guidelines today.
The Centers for Disease Control and Prevention (CDC), Atlanta
The CDC operates the Autism and Developmental Disabilities Monitoring (ADDM) Network, the most comprehensive ongoing surveillance system tracking autism prevalence across multiple U.S. states, and also publishes the largest national data on ADHD prevalence through the National Survey of Children’s Health. Nearly every prevalence statistic cited in academic and media coverage of these conditions traces back to CDC data collection.
The National Institute of Mental Health (NIMH)
NIMH funds much of the foundational neuroscience research into both conditions, including large longitudinal studies tracking brain development in children with ADHD and autism over time. Its public-facing resources are widely used as authoritative references in academic writing on these topics.
The American Academy of Pediatrics (AAP)
The AAP publishes the clinical practice guidelines that most U.S. pediatricians follow when screening for, diagnosing, and managing both ADHD and autism, including specific age-based screening recommendations and evidence-graded treatment algorithms.
Russell Barkley: Executive Function and ADHD
Russell Barkley, a clinical psychologist and researcher, has been one of the most influential voices reframing ADHD as fundamentally a disorder of executive function and self-regulation rather than simply an attention problem. His model helped shift clinical and public understanding away from viewing ADHD symptoms as willful misbehavior.
Lorna Wing and the Concept of the Autism Spectrum
Lorna Wing, a British psychiatrist, was instrumental in developing the modern concept of autism as a spectrum rather than a single, narrowly defined condition. Her work in the 1970s and 1980s, alongside colleague Judith Gould, directly shaped the DSM-5’s move toward a single, dimensional Autism Spectrum Disorder category, replacing the previously separate diagnoses of autistic disorder and Asperger’s syndrome.
The National Autistic Society (UK) and Autism Speaks (US)
These advocacy and support organizations, alongside numerous smaller autistic-led groups, provide resources for families, fund research, and shape public policy conversations in their respective countries, though the field increasingly emphasizes centering autistic voices directly in research and advocacy design rather than speaking solely on behalf of autistic people.

Frequently Asked Questions About ADHD and Autism
What is the main difference between ADHD and autism?
ADHD is defined by persistent inattention, hyperactivity, and impulsivity, reflecting a core difficulty regulating attention and behavior. Autism Spectrum Disorder is defined by differences in social communication and restricted, repetitive patterns of behavior or interests. ADHD primarily affects how a child manages attention and impulse control; autism primarily affects how a child processes social information and sensory input. The two conditions can occur separately or together in the same individual, and DSM-5 permits both diagnoses simultaneously.
Can a child have both ADHD and autism at the same time?
Yes. Studies estimate that a substantial proportion of children with autism also meet full diagnostic criteria for ADHD, and the reverse overlap is also well documented. DSM-5 explicitly changed its rules to allow both diagnoses in the same person, correcting an exclusion rule from earlier editions of the manual. Children with both conditions often show greater functional impairment than children with either condition alone, which makes accurate dual diagnosis clinically important.
At what age can ADHD and autism be diagnosed?
Autism can often be reliably identified by age two or three, and pediatric guidelines recommend formal screening at the 18-month and 24-month well-child visits. ADHD is typically diagnosed later, usually between ages four and twelve, once a child is in a structured school environment where attention, impulse control, and behavior can be meaningfully compared against same-age peers across multiple settings.
What causes ADHD and autism spectrum disorder?
Both conditions result from a combination of genetic and neurological factors that shape brain development, primarily before birth. Twin and family studies place heritability above 70 percent for each condition, and genome-wide studies have identified many contributing genetic variants rather than a single causal gene. Prenatal factors such as premature birth and low birth weight are associated with elevated risk. No single gene, vaccine, dietary factor, or parenting approach has been shown to cause either condition.
Is ADHD or autism more common in boys or girls?
Both conditions are diagnosed more often in boys than girls, but researchers believe this gap partly reflects underdiagnosis in girls rather than a true difference in underlying rates. Girls with ADHD more frequently present with the inattentive subtype, which is less disruptive and easier to overlook, while girls with autism are more likely to mask social difficulties, which can delay diagnosis well into adolescence or adulthood.
Do children outgrow ADHD or autism?
Neither condition is typically “outgrown” in the sense of disappearing entirely. Roughly 60 percent of children with ADHD continue to show significant symptoms into adulthood, though many develop effective coping strategies over time. Autism is a lifelong neurodevelopmental difference; while some individuals develop strong coping and masking skills that reduce visible impairment, the underlying difference in social processing and sensory experience persists throughout life.
What is the difference between ASD Level 1, 2, and 3?
DSM-5 uses severity levels to describe the amount of support a person needs. Level 1 (“requiring support”) describes noticeable difficulty initiating social interactions without support but relatively independent daily functioning. Level 2 (“requiring substantial support”) describes marked deficits evident even with support in place. Level 3 (“requiring very substantial support”) describes severe deficits in both social communication and behavioral flexibility that significantly limit independent functioning across nearly all settings.
Can ADHD medication help an autistic child who also has attention difficulties?
Yes, stimulant and non-stimulant ADHD medications are sometimes prescribed to autistic children with co-occurring ADHD symptoms, though research suggests response rates and side-effect profiles can differ somewhat from children with ADHD alone. Medication decisions in this population are typically made carefully, in consultation with a developmental pediatrician or child psychiatrist experienced with autism, alongside behavioral and educational supports rather than as a stand-alone treatment.
How can teachers support students with ADHD or autism in the classroom?
Effective classroom strategies include breaking instructions into short, clear steps, providing visual schedules and advance warning before transitions, offering movement breaks, using preferential seating away from distractions, and pairing verbal instructions with written or visual backup. For students with autism, reducing unnecessary sensory input, such as harsh lighting or unpredictable noise, and being explicit rather than relying on implied social rules can meaningfully reduce daily stress and improve engagement.
